It’s quintessential for any organization to underline itself as a system that works. Be it a school, army, workplace, family or society, there success depends on selling a belief that learning, defense, productivity, values or life is a cosmos. There are well defined process, rules and practices which when followed diligently yields a perfect and desired result.

Like hell, it works!!

The success of a system is in not working continually. It’s in creating an impression that it works continually and any failure is due to lack of compliance by the participant. Once it’s established as a fact that when a student fails, its lack of hard work and dedication of the student and not because of ambiguity on the part of educational system, the myth becomes self propagating. A failed student is considered an anomaly and its made an example to prevent many more going that way, even though majority are gravitated towards the scary “F”. The day most people fail, schools will have to reinvent themselves.

Of course, questioning all the elements of a system will breed anarchy.


But reiterating the system, without adulterating it with doubts fortify falsehood that hard work is rewarded, sincerity is met with its likeness, practice makes one perfect, love exists, training doesn’t fail, happy endings and yada yada yada ... without explicitly stating that things do go wrong, failure cannot always be analyzed, success cannot always be guaranteed, you don’t have to be successful to say that failure is ok, pressure don’t always turn carbon to diamond ...
